Know How to Create Pattern of Pattern and Different Options of Pattern Deletion | PTC Creo

In this Tech Tip, Know how to Create a Pattern of an already Created Pattern. We will use Advanced Options of the Pattern Feature. You will also know how to delete this pattern in different ways.

Creating a Pattern of an already Created Pattern –
Step 1

Select Extrude 2 from Model Tree, right click and select the pattern feature.
Step 2
Select Pattern type as Axis.

Step 3

Select the DATUM AXIS as shown.
Step 4

Select the number of members as 4 and the spacing angle as 360.
Click ok.
Step 5
This will create 4 extrudes as shown in the figure.

Step 7

Select Pattern of Extrude 2 from Model Tree,
then right-click and select the pattern feature.
Step 8
Select Pattern Type as Direction.

Step 9

Select the edge as the reference of direction as shown in the below image.
Step 10

Flip the direction of the 1st Direction and then Select the number of members as 3 and the spacing as 250.
Click ok.
Step 11
Now the Pattern of Pattern has been created.
Note:
After creating Pattern of Pattern, you cannot create a pattern for the same feature. You can only create one pattern of a pattern.

Know Different options for the Deletion of Pattern feature –
Step 1

Select Pattern 2 of Pattern 1 from Model Tree,
then right-click and select Delete.
Step 2

This will delete everything
i.e. 2 patterns along with pattern leader.
Step 3
Click Undo to Undelete.
We will delete this step-by-step and in a systematic order.
Step 4
Select Pattern 2 of Pattern 1 from Model Tree,
then right-click and select Delete Pattern.

Step 5

Now the pattern of the pattern is deleted.
Now check if the name is displayed as Pattern 1 of Extrude 2.

Step 6

Now, Select Pattern 1 of Extrude 2 from Model Tree,
then right-click and select Delete Pattern.
Step 7
Now only Extrude 2 will remain and Pattern 1 will be deleted.
